NEMETH, Mayor COUNTY -CITY BUILDING SOUTH BEND, INDIANA 46601 o13\_UT10* LU 2 Z a /NDIMAN 219/284 -9742 February 9, 1977 Members of the Common Council Council Chambers, 4th Floor County City Building South Bend, Indiana Dear Council Members: This appropriation is to provide funds for the City's share of the E -3 and E -5 Code Enforcement Programs. The $221,000 addressed in this ordinance is to pro- vide repayment to the Redevelopment Revolving Fund for the cost overrun on these projects. This re- payment is based on the final audit report on these projects, dated June 26, 1974. In this audit report it was indicated that $221,000 of other project funds was used in completing these projects, and this money would have to be repaid with local funds in order to permit completion of the other projects. Redevelopment is approaching final completion on the R -66 project, and this money will be required to complete final relocation payments for the R -66 project close -out. Sincere PeteV A.
